Transaction 580eacddfae5c656ddfe1a333b107916db124cd29ab3ee13020af0139ab7e2bb
1 Input
2 Outputs
- 580eacddfae5c656ddfe1a333b107916db124cd29ab3ee13020af0139ab7e2bb:0
- 580eacddfae5c656ddfe1a333b107916db124cd29ab3ee13020af0139ab7e2bb:1
value 1000
address 2NFmfdjthm6eYyD5VBSjM7dZ3mtbCY6x4Ct
value 129567369
address mzZ9iRz55X89RwisWMoVbpUSBudPw1JZ9C